If the tyres are new, they may still be
covered with a slippery film: drive
carefully for the first miles. Do not oil
the tyres with unsuitable fluids. If the
tyres are old, even if not completely
worn out, they may become hard and
may not ensure good road holding.
In this case, replace them.
MINIMUM TREAD DEPTH LIMIT (3):
front and rear 2 mm and in any case not
less than prescribed by the regulations in
force in the country where the vehicle is
used.

ENGINE OIL

WARNING
Engine oil may cause serious damage
to the skin if handled daily and for long
periods.
Wash your hands carefully after use.
KEEP AWAY FROM CHILDREN.
DO NOT DISPOSE OF THE OIL IN THE
ENVIRONMENT.
Put it in a sealed container and take it to
the filling station where you usually buy
it or to an oil salvage center.
In case any maintenance operation
should be required, it is advisable to
use latex gloves.
CAUTION
If the engine oil pressure warning light
"
" comes on during the normal
operation of the engine, this means that
the engine oil pressure in the circuit is
insufficient.
In this case, check the engine oil level,
see p. 55 (CHECKING THE ENGINE OIL
LEVEL AND TOPPING UP); if the level
i s n ' t c o r r e c t , s t o p t h e e n g i n e
immediately and contact an aprilia
Official Dealer.

Periodically check the engine oil level, see
p. 55 (CHECKING THE ENGINE OIL
LEVEL AND TOPPING UP).
For the engine oil change, see p. 52
( R E G U L A R S E R V I C E I N T E R V A L S
CHART).
NOTE
Use high-quality 5W – 40 oil, see
p. 93 (LUBRICANT CHART).
